So far all the APIs we used would happily respond to any request. In reality, most APIs hold sensitive information that should not be accessible for everyone. In order to guard the data APIs use some way to authenticate the user. The simplest form of authentication is called basic. Similarly to how you log in to a website, the basic authentication expect a username and a password. This is sent in the request as part of the header, under the type: Authorization. The content of the header is: Basic <username>:<password>. Naturally, there is catch. The username and password are not sent as plain text, but need to be encoded in base64, which is a way of encoding text for use in HTTP.
For this exercise you need to write a program thats calls the API https://restapiabasicauthe-sandbox.mxapps.io/api/books and prints the response to the console.
You need to use the credentials admin:hvgX8KlVEa to authenticate.
Step 1. Feel free to copy and modify the code from the previous exercise.
Step 2. Visit https://www.base64encode.org/ to convert admin:hvgX8KlVEa to base64
Step 3. Set the authorization header in the GET request - fetch(<URL>,{ headers: { 'Authorization': 'Basic XXXXXX' } }
Step 4. Print the response
Bonus points if you can encode the username and password to base64 using javascript code.

This week we'll add our external API that we're going to work with: Open Weather Map. The goal this week is to learn how to use data from the frontend to use in an API call from the backend, and then to send the result back to the frontend.
- We first have to make an account: do so via the website
- Go back to your project folder and create a new folder called
sources. Inside create a file calledkeys.json. Go to your OpenWeatherMap account, find the API Key and copy it intokeys.json
- First remove the response from last week
- Inside of the the
POSTroute, bring inaxiosand pass the value of the API endpoint:https://api.openweathermap.org/data/2.5/weather. For it to work we first have to add the API Key, like so:
const APIKEY = require('./sources/secrets.json').API_KEY;
axios(`https://api.openweathermap.org/data/2.5/weather?APPID=${API_KEY}`);Now, there are 2 situations that could happen: if the city name is not found, we want to send to the client a response with a message that the city isn't found. However, if the city is found and then we want to return a message that contains the city name and current temperature.
- If the result is not found, we
render()to the page theindex(just like in the/endpoint). However, also add a second argument, an object:{ weatherText: "City is not found!" } - If the result is found, we also
render()to the page theindex. Also add here the object. Only, instead of just a string dynamically add in thecityNameand temperature (gotten from the result of the API call). Hint: use template strings to add variables in your strings!
In the frontend we're going to add one thing:
- Navigate to
index.handlebars. Underneath the<form>, add a<p>. Give it the following content:{{ weatherText }}(Notice how the nameweatherTextrefers back to the key in the object passed in therender())
Now test out your work to see if it behaves as expected. Run your server with node server.js. Open your browser at the right port and fill in the form. On submit there should appear a message underneath the form, that either says that the city isn't found or what the temperature is.
